Обновление платформы MetaTrader 4 билд 625: Журналы в MetaTrader Market и новый MetaViewer - страница 47
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
С какого-то билда появились проблемы с табуляциями в эдиторе:
в 5.00.914 с табуляцией все нормально.
Здравствуйте.
У меня вопрос: Советник не видит значения стандартных индикаторов
Вот код -
"
int IndicatorSignal()
{
int Sig=0;
double RSI_1=iRSI(Symbol(),0,RSI_per,PRICE_CLOSE,shift);
double STOH_S0=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_SIGNAL,shift);
double STOH_S1=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_SIGNAL,shift+1);
double STOH_M0=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_MAIN,shift);
double STOH_M1=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_MAIN,shift+1);
if(proverka)
{
if(RSI_1>UP_RSI && STOH_M1>STOH_S1 && STOH_M0<STOH_S0 && STOH_M0>UP_STOH && Open[1]>Close[1])Sig=2;
else if(RSI_1>UP_RSI && STOH_M1>STOH_S1 && STOH_M0<STOH_S0 && STOH_M0>UP_STOH)Sig=2;
}
if(proverka)
{
if(RSI_1<DOWN_RSI && STOH_M1<STOH_S1 && STOH_M0>STOH_S0 && STOH_M0<DOWN_STOH && Open[1]<Close[1])Sig=2;
else if(RSI_1<DOWN_RSI && STOH_M1<STOH_S1 && STOH_M0>STOH_S0 && STOH_M0<DOWN_STOH)Sig=1;
}
if(STOH_S0>UP_STOH)Sig=3;
if(STOH_S0<DOWN_STOH)Sig=4;
// 1 - бай 2 - селл, 3 - закрытие бай, 4 - закрытие селл
return(Sig);
}
"
Вот скрин
В значениях Окно индикатора 1 и 2 нету названий индикаторов, а только значения.
Кстати до вчерашнего дня все работало нормально, а теперь не работает.
В чем проблема?
Господа Метаквоты, реализовать прозрачность слоев и окон Вы точно не потяните, а не слабо добавить цветам прозрачность?
Здравствуйте.
У меня вопрос: Советник не видит значения стандартных индикаторов
Вот код -
"
int IndicatorSignal()
{
int Sig=0;
double RSI_1=iRSI(Symbol(),0,RSI_per,PRICE_CLOSE,shift);
double STOH_S0=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_SIGNAL,shift);
double STOH_S1=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_SIGNAL,shift+1);
double STOH_M0=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_MAIN,shift);
double STOH_M1=iStochastic(Symbol(),0,STOH_K,STOH_D,STOH_Z,MODE_SMA,0,MODE_MAIN,shift+1);
if(proverka)
{
if(RSI_1>UP_RSI && STOH_M1>STOH_S1 && STOH_M0<STOH_S0 && STOH_M0>UP_STOH && Open[1]>Close[1])Sig=2;
else if(RSI_1>UP_RSI && STOH_M1>STOH_S1 && STOH_M0<STOH_S0 && STOH_M0>UP_STOH)Sig=2;
}
Print ("1= ", Sig);
if(proverka)
{
if(RSI_1<DOWN_RSI && STOH_M1<STOH_S1 && STOH_M0>STOH_S0 && STOH_M0<DOWN_STOH && Open[1]<Close[1])Sig=2;
else if(RSI_1<DOWN_RSI && STOH_M1<STOH_S1 && STOH_M0>STOH_S0 && STOH_M0<DOWN_STOH)Sig=1;
}
Print ("2= ", Sig);
if(STOH_S0>UP_STOH)Sig=3;
Print ("3= ", Sig);
if(STOH_S0<DOWN_STOH)Sig=4;
Print ("4= ", Sig);
// 1 - бай 2 - селл, 3 - закрытие бай, 4 - закрытие селл
return(Sig);
}
"
Вот скрин
В значениях Окно индикатора 1 и 2 нету названий индикаторов, а только значения.
Кстати до вчерашнего дня все работало нормально, а теперь не работает.
В чем проблема?
Не работает поиск во вкладке "Указатель" в справке клиентского терминала МТ4. В списке указателя один единственный пункт "настройка графика".
И где в терминале можно найти справочную инфу о счете и об инструменте (плечо, размер маржи на лот, спреды и тд и тп) не используя функции MQL и не заглядывая в договоры?
Вставьте операторы печати после каждого условия и сами догадаетесь, в чем проблема.
Спасибо)))) Нашёл решение проблемы))))
Несколько страниц назад я обращался за разъяснением проблемы неадекватного поведения МТ. До этого обращался в сервисдеск. На форуме было сказано что исправят... тогда я закрыл заявку в сервисдеске, но вот реакция тех.поддержки на скрине.
Что-то никаких сдвигов... Может забыли???
Несколько страниц назад я обращался за разъяснением проблемы неадекватного поведения МТ. До этого обращался в сервисдеск. На форуме было сказано что исправят... тогда я закрыл заявку в сервисдеске, но вот реакция тех.поддержки на скрине.
Что-то никаких сдвигов... Может забыли???
Почему забыли? Сами же попросили не закрывать.
Исправят значит.
И где в терминале можно найти справочную инфу о счете и об инструменте (плечо, размер маржи на лот, спреды и тд и тп) не используя функции MQL и не заглядывая в договоры?
Нигде. Ловите скрипты, выводят на экран всю эту инфу.
Кстати, закину-ка я их в базу кодов.